Mercedes-Benz USA Reports 84,500 Retail Sales in Q2 2026

  • Mercedes-Benz USA retailed 84,500 vehicles in Q2 2026, including 75,000 passenger cars and 9,500 vans.
  • Customer demand for the brand’s SUV portfolio remained particularly strong, led by year-over-year growth for the GLE (+30%), GLC (+8%) and GLB (+40%).
  • Mercedes-Maybach retail sales increased 25% and AMG sales grew 1.5% for the quarter.

ATLANTA--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Mercedes-Benz USA (MBUSA) reported retail sales of 84,500 vehicles in the second quarter of 2026, comprised of 75,000 passenger cars and 9,500 vans. Strong demand for SUVs remained a key driver of Q2 sales performance, with the Alabama-built GLE reporting nearly 30% year-over-year growth and the Mercedes-Maybach GLS, Mercedes-AMG SUVs, the GLC and the GLB also each posting strong year-over-year gains. Together, these models supported performance across Entry, Core and Top-End segments, underscoring a strong foundation as Mercedes-Benz prepares to bring many refreshed and all-new vehicles to market in the second half of the year, including the all-electric GLC, a refreshed GLE and GLS and a new S-Class.

Top-End:

Mercedes-Maybach retail sales grew 25% in the second quarter, reflecting sustained demand for the company’s pinnacle luxury models. The Maybach GLS stood out as a key contributor to the segment's performance, while demand for high-performance utility vehicles also remained robust with AMG SUV sales increasing 17% in the quarter.

Core:

SUVs remained the cornerstone of the Core segment in the second quarter. The GLE delivered the strongest performance in the Mercedes-Benz lineup, with retail sales increasing nearly 30% year-over-year. The GLC also remained one of the brand’s highest-volume vehicles and a key contributor to the strength of the Core segment.

Entry:

The GLB led growth in the Entry segment during the second quarter, with retail sales increasing 40% year-over-year. Its strong performance reflects continued customer demand for versatile and accessible luxury SUVs, while serving as an important gateway to the Mercedes-Benz portfolio.

Vans:

Mercedes-Benz Vans retail sales increased 4.4% in the second quarter resulting in 9,500 units. The business continues to benefit from demand for premium commercial transportation solutions while supporting customers with a broad portfolio of versatile offerings to meet any transportation need.

Mercedes-Benz Group:

In the second quarter of 2026, Mercedes-Benz Group sold 511,900 cars and vans, up quarter-on-quarter (+2%), despite ongoing macroeconomic and geopolitical headwinds and softer consumer sentiment in parts of Asia. Driven by strong demand for new model launches, Group-wide sales of battery-electric vehicles increased 50% year-over-year.

About Mercedes-Benz USA

Mercedes-Benz USA (MBUSA), headquartered in Atlanta, is responsible for the distribution, marketing and customer service for all Mercedes-Benz products in the United States. MBUSA offers drivers the most diverse lineup in the luxury segment with 18 model lines ranging from the sporty GLA SUV to the flagship S-Class and the dynamic all-electric vehicles from Mercedes-Benz. MBUSA is also responsible for Mercedes-Benz Vans in the U.S. More information on MBUSA and its products can be found at www.mbusa.com and www.mbvans.com.
